Navigate a Digital Landscape in Exist.EXE
In Exist.EXE, a pixel-art puzzle adventure for PC, players step into Marcus's shoes — a game developer grappling with the loss of his mother. This narrative-driven experience pulls you into a digital realm where programming skills transform grief into creativity. The world challenges players to confront emotional scenarios while utilizing a distinct hacking mechanic that morphs objects, reflecting Marcus's journey of self-discovery.
Hacking as a Tool for Emotion and Growth
The core mechanic of Exist.EXE centers around hacking-based puzzles that feel intuitive and rewarding. Solving these puzzles goes beyond simple gameplay; it's a means for Marcus to change the environment and, metaphorically, his emotional state. Every object you hack uncovers layers of his memories, allowing players to reshape both his world and his mindset. These interactions bring a refreshing depth to problem-solving and encourage players to think critically about their actions.
A Journey Through Grief and Memory
The narrative weaves a poignant tale. Marcus finds himself drawn to a perfect digital world created by an AI that resembles his late mother. This idyllic landscape tempts him to escape his sadness. However, a voice from the past, his best friend, reminds him that true healing requires facing reality. Each decision becomes a key part of the story. Players must navigate these emotional landscapes while deciding what it means to live authentically.
Craft Your Own Challenges in a Pixel Paradise
One innovative feature of Exist.EXE is the in-game level editor. Here, players can design and construct their own puzzles, fostering creativity and community engagement. Share your challenges with others, and see how they solve the problems you concoct. This function enriches the experience, extending the game's life beyond its built-in narrative. It also encourages collaboration among players, fostering a vibrant creative community.
